Transaction 8c21a09225879a21cc832d613e29c09dd65ed90954a52b6feef870441b5ffa98
1 Input
1 Output
-
8c21a09225879a21cc832d613e29c09dd65ed90954a52b6feef870441b5ffa98:0
- value
- 6638160
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f58210f991f43406af6b95d90f0e8e32fb013945 OP_EQUAL
- address
- 3Q59Hi13vUMzgNJ3fvPEBa9GwDCcGjCq5J